About the Company

Based in Vancouver, Eldorado Gold is one of Canada`s intermediate gold mining companies with shares trading on the Toronto (TSX: ELD) and New York (NYSE: EGO) stock exchanges. Eldorado`s operations are global and the Company has assets in Turkey, Greece, Romania, Serbia, Canada and Brazil. Eldorado`s activities involve all facets of mining, including exploration, development, production and reclamation. In 2016, Eldorado produced over 485,000 ounces of gold and had proven and probable gold reserves of approximately 19 million ounces at year-end. Eldorado operates the largest gold mine in Turkey and is one of the largest foreign investors in Greece. The Company`s offices and operations employ over 4,800 people worldwide. Eldorado operates as a decentralized business unit with the majority of employees and management being nationals of the country where offices are located. Eldorado`s success to date is based on a highly skilled and dedicated workforce, safe and responsible operations, a portfolio of high-quality assets, and long-term partnerships with the communities where it operates.
